Australian watchdog sues Facebook over ‘privacy’ app alleging it harvested users’ data instead
Australia’s consumer regulator has launched proceedings against Facebook and its subsidiaries over virtual private network (VPN) app Onavo Protect, alleging it harvested data without users’ consent. The Australian Competition and Consumer Commission (ACCC) said on Wednesday it was seeking to impose an unspecified fine on Facebook for engaging into “false, misleading or deceptive conduct.” While the tech giant has been promoting Onavo Protect as a tool to “keep users’ personal activity data private,” the application turned out to be doing exactly the opposite, the watchdog claimed.
